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Glenwood Springs

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Bait-and-Switch

Quotes cheap repair by phone, arrives and claims 'major damage' needing full replacement at triple the price.

🚫

Upfront Payment Ghosting

Takes full payment for parts/labor upfront, does minimal work or vanishes.

🚫

Unnecessary Replacement

Says springs/opener/door must be fully replaced when simple fix works.

🚫

Fake Emergency Response

Calls or shows up uninvited claiming to fix 'dangerous' door from afar.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Request a Certificate of Insurance (COI) naming you as additional insured. Call the insurance company to confirm it's active and covers liability/property damage.

2

Licensing

Colorado doesn't require statewide general contractor licenses, but check DORA.colorado.gov for trade licenses (e.g., electrical). Verify local Garfield County or Glenwood Springs business registration via county clerk or city hall.

3

References

Ask for 3+ recent local references in Glenwood Springs area. Call them to ask about work quality, timeliness, and if they'd hire again.

Protection FAQs

Do garage door repair pros need a license in Glenwood Springs?

No statewide requirement in CO, but check DORA for trades and Garfield County/Glenwood Springs for local registration.

Should I pay upfront for garage door repair?

Only a small deposit (10-20%). Never full amount until work is done.

How can I spot a bait-and-switch scam?

Insist on written quotes before work. If price jumps hugely onsite, walk away.

Is insurance important for garage door techs?

Yes—protects your home if they damage property or get hurt.

What if it's a garage door emergency?

Still verify licensing/insurance quickly. Consider matching services for pre-screened pros.

How do I check online reviews safely?

Use Google, BBB, Angi. Look for patterns in recent Glenwood Springs reviews, ignore fakes.

What warranties should trustworthy pros offer?

Written guarantees on labor (1+ year) and parts from reputable brands.
